The Adult Child of Abuse

You came into our lives like a storm
We fear it's not the norm.
Our life has a secret past
We knew it would never last.
We wondered what you'd want from us
Maybe it's only out trust.
What you took was our soul
Our story never to be told.
We keep to ourselves out of fear
Our secrets you don't want to hear.
For when we expose our life
It is used against us in a fight.
Our trust we must keep hidden
For friends are forbidden.
Because you see, us children of abuse
Grow into adults of recluse.

We pray each day for peace of mind
But, we know that is unkind.
For when we try
All we do is cry.
Our pain is real
And our fate is sealed.
The questions we ask
We're taken to task.
So, here we are, feeling depressed
Again our thoughts suppressed.
Us children of abuse
That grow into adults of recluse.

You had so much control
You didn't know what you stole.
So much violence
Made us so silent.
A lifetime of waste
Was not in haste.
We thought you were strong
But we were so wrong.
Us children of abuse 
That grew into adults of recluse.

Life was tense
It didn't make sense.
So young of mind
We didn't know at the time.
Torn from family and friends
How can we ever fit in.
In a crowd we feel alone
So we flee to the walls of home.
Answers we always seek
But questions are ours to keep.
Our thoughts we can't turn off
We wonder does it ever stop.
Us children of abuse
That grow into adults of recluse.

We have so much to give
For we so want to live.
But over and over it fails 
Because of each of our tale.
Through the years there was tranquility
We know that sounds silly.
For when it comes we sabotage totally
But we go forward ever so boldly.
Us children of abuse
That grow into adults of recluse.

The abuser is often not caught
Never knowing what they taught.
A lifetime of pain and untrust
That will forever live in us.
So, we keep our feelings within
So others won't look in.
After all these years of unjust
Why does it still bother us.
Now it's the tail end of our lives
And, we have survived.
But all is good 
As it should.
Our mind and soul will heal
Our fate is not sealed.
Now you see, why us children of abuse
Have become adults of recluse no more!
